Is Your DataBank Open For Business?

There’s a big difference between a database and a databank - one is just a collection of names, and the other is the most valuable asset we own in our businesses.

Every real estate agent should be intentional about their databanks, especially in a tight-inventory, highly-competitive, shifting market, like the one we’re in right now.

How do we deposit into our databanks so we can extract more gold from it? Why will the agents with databanks thrive when the market shifts?

In this episode, we’re joined by special guest host, Abe Safa. He shares how to be more deliberate with our databanks, whether we have 50 or 5000 people.

"If all you have are names and numbers, that’s not a databank, that’s just a list." -Abe Safa

Three Things You’ll Learn In This Episode

  • How to make our conversations easier
    How do we become such a solid resource for our datanks so that we’re top of mind in the confusion and uncertainty of a shifting market?
  • Why we can’t take the gas off our database-building activities
    Building a databank is an ongoing process, why is it so critical to start early and constantly replenish it?
  • The first step to getting more value out of our databanks
    Why is it so important to segment and filter our databanks, and how do we actually do it?
